Matt Brown

Thanks to his banjo-playing father, Matt grew up with old-time music. He studied classical violin with Linda Litwin and Richard Amoroso, and old-time music with Brad Leftwich, Bruce Molsky, Paul Brown, Ginny Hawker, and Tracy Schwarz. He has appeared at The Kennedy Center's Millennium Stage and the Philadelphia Folk Festival, has toured as a soloist, with Rhythm in Shoes and Footworks Percussive Dance Ensemble, and has made guest appearances with Tim O'Brien, Della Mae, Uncle Earl, and with Mike Snider on the Grand Ole Opry. Matt has released five albums, including My Native Home, which features collaborations with Tim O’Brien, Ben Krakauer, Brittany Haas, and Mark Schatz. Matt's latest album, Speed of the Plow, comprises old-time fiddle and guitar duets with Greg Reish. He has taught at The Colorado Suzuki Institute, The Rocky Mountain Fiddle Camp, The Swannanoa Gathering, and Southern Week at Ashokan, and has taught workshops at Berklee College of Music and Morehead State University.
